Transaction 18254bb9e882768212d75902f41ed2e5a4b6daf9ac2d93b175bf2ddeb7745b70
1 Input
1 Output
-
18254bb9e882768212d75902f41ed2e5a4b6daf9ac2d93b175bf2ddeb7745b70:0
- value
- 29966514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ba098077b4a4b4779a033cbe1a51d3614748a6e OP_EQUAL
- address
- 3CxhRPw3zScM2zzTHTLG1LvwCKNoaPqNG3